The Role of Local News in Announcing Obituaries

Local news outlets, like the Ipseibataviase Daily News, have traditionally been the cornerstone for announcing deaths and memorial services. These announcements serve as a public record and a way for the community to collectively mourn and remember those who have passed. Obituaries published in newspapers provide detailed accounts of the deceased's life, including their achievements, family, and funeral arrangements. This allows friends, acquaintances, and community members to pay their respects and offer support to the grieving family. Local newspapers build community trust and provide a platform for important announcements that impact the local citizenry. Keeping the community up-to-date through daily news is the most important task of the newspaper. For many years, the Ipseibataviase Daily News has diligently served its readers by providing timely and accurate obituaries. The advent of digital media has brought significant changes, offering both opportunities and challenges. While the traditional print format remains, many newspapers now maintain a strong online presence, extending their reach and accessibility. This digital transformation allows news outlets to provide real-time updates and interactive features, enhancing the way obituaries are shared and accessed.

Facebook as a Modern Memorial

Facebook has transformed how we share and receive information, and obituaries are no exception. The platform allows news outlets like the Ipseibataviase Daily News to quickly disseminate information to a broad audience. Sharing obituaries on Facebook offers several advantages. It provides immediate notification to friends and family, especially those who may no longer reside in the local area or subscribe to the print newspaper. This digital reach ensures that more people can be informed promptly, allowing them to offer their condolences and support. Facebook also serves as a virtual gathering place for sharing memories and condolences. The comments section of an obituary post becomes a space where friends, family, and community members can share their memories, express their grief, and offer support to the bereaved. This collective sharing of memories can provide comfort and solace to the grieving family, knowing that their loved one's life touched many others. The interactive nature of Facebook allows for a more dynamic and participatory form of mourning. Individuals can post photos, videos, and personal anecdotes, creating a richer and more comprehensive tribute to the deceased. This multimedia approach goes beyond the traditional written obituary, offering a more personal and engaging way to remember and celebrate the life of the departed. However, it's important to approach these online spaces with sensitivity and respect. Remember that you're engaging with real people who are grieving, and your words and actions should reflect empathy and compassion.

Respectful Engagement: Dos and Don'ts

When engaging with obituaries on Facebook, it's crucial to maintain a high level of respect and sensitivity. Here are some dos and don'ts to guide your interactions: Do offer sincere condolences. A simple message like "My deepest condolences to the family" can go a long way in providing comfort. Do share positive memories and anecdotes about the deceased. Sharing a fond memory can help celebrate their life and bring smiles to those who are grieving. Do offer practical support if you are able. If the family needs help with meals, errands, or other tasks, offer your assistance. Do respect the family's privacy. Avoid asking intrusive questions or sharing personal information without their permission. Don't post insensitive or inappropriate comments. This includes making jokes, sharing negative stories, or using offensive language. Don't use the obituary post to promote yourself or your business. This is not the time for self-promotion. Don't argue or engage in conflict in the comments section. The focus should be on supporting the grieving family, not starting disagreements. Remember that the online space is a reflection of the community's shared grief and respect. Your actions should contribute to a supportive and compassionate environment. Be mindful of the language you use and the tone of your messages. Avoid using slang or informal language that could be misinterpreted. Stick to respectful and considerate communication.

Preserving Memories in the Digital Age

The rise of social media has transformed how we remember and honor the deceased. Facebook provides a unique platform for preserving memories and creating lasting tributes. One of the ways to preserve memories is by creating a memorial page on Facebook. This page can serve as a central location for sharing photos, videos, and stories about the deceased. Family and friends can contribute to the page, creating a collaborative tribute that captures the essence of the person's life. Memorial pages can also be used to announce memorial services, share updates, and coordinate support for the family. Another way to preserve memories is by archiving online obituaries. Many news outlets, including the Ipseibataviase Daily News, maintain online archives of obituaries. These archives provide a valuable resource for future generations who want to learn about their ancestors and community members. By archiving obituaries, we ensure that the stories of those who have passed are not forgotten. Facebook also allows for the creation of private groups for sharing memories and supporting grieving families. These groups provide a safe and intimate space for sharing personal stories and offering condolences. Private groups can be particularly helpful for families who want to grieve in a more private setting, away from the public eye.
